Enscape for Mac is a real-time rendering and VR plugin that officially supports Archicad. It allows architects and designers to visualize their BIM models instantly within their macOS environment, bridging the gap between design and high-quality visualization. Core Features for Mac Users
Archicad’s native surface materials map directly into Enscape. However, to achieve true photorealism, you can use Enscape’s Material Editor. You can add depth to surfaces using bump maps, adjust roughness to dictate how light reflects off a polished concrete floor, or inject self-illumination properties to create glowing LED strips. 5. Use the Enscape Material Editor to refine textures, adjust reflectivity, and apply height maps (bump/displacement) to standard Archicad surfaces.
